Bentleyville is a borough in Washington County, Pennsylvania, situated within a region characterized by diverse natural landscapes. The area features lush forests, rolling hills, and rivers, providing a varied terrain that supports a range of outdoor pursuits. Its location offers access to extensive trail networks, making it suitable for several sports like hiking and road cycling.

The Bentleyville region provides access to a variety of hiking trails. Notable options include local paths like the Arboretum Trail and Blair Brothers Trail. Hikers can also explore sections of the Great Allegheny Passage and the Mon River Rail-Trail System, which offer well-maintained routes. Yes, Bentleyville is suitable for road cycling, featuring well-maintained paths. Cyclists can access sections of the Great Allegheny Passage and the Mon River Rail-Trail System, which are often converted from former railway lines. These routes are generally flat and accessible. The Bentleyville region includes trails suitable for beginners and those seeking easier routes. Rail-trails like the Great Allegheny Passage and the Mon River Rail-Trail System are known for their relatively flat and well-maintained surfaces. These paths are ideal for leisurely walks and cycling. Local options such as the Arboretum Trail also offer accessible experiences.

Yes, the Bentleyville area offers family-friendly outdoor options, particularly on its rail-trails. The Great Allegheny Passage and the Mon River Rail-Trail System provide relatively flat and safe paths suitable for families with children. These trails are ideal for leisurely walks and bike rides, offering accessible outdoor experiences.

Yes, Bentleyville provides access to sections of significant long-distance trail systems. These include the Great Allegheny Passage and the Mon River Rail-Trail System. These extensive networks offer opportunities for multi-day trips or longer excursions, connecting various communities and natural areas.
